They won't bother me anymore.

It means the speaker believes the problem or harassment has ended.

Usage Scenario

Use this when you want to say someone will stop causing trouble or annoyance. It sounds natural in everyday speech and can be reassuring.

Better ways to say it

1
They won't bother me anymore.
2
I won't have to deal with them anymore.
3
They're not going to bother me anymore.
